The Benefits of Earning Online Graduate Degrees

As technology progresses, it takes with it almost every aspect in our lives. The internet has brought wonders to our lives in more ways than one. Today, getting an education doesn't have to mean physically attending lectures; thanks to online technology. Online graduate degrees are offered by a lot of learning institutions these days. This advantageous mode of earning one's self a college degree makes it possible to attend the school of your choice, no matter where you are in the world.

Upon meeting the specified minimum requirements, you can have yourself enrolled. There are several online graduate degree programs available in various fields, from accounting, marketing, law, psychology and many others. Since everything is done online, there is a flexibility of schedule. This means that you don't have to quit your current job to attend school; you can keep it at the same time you are earning your degree.

Lessons are held in a virtual classroom, where you participate with other students from different places in the world. Documents, assignments, examinations, and other learning aids are distributed online, in the form of e-mails, forums and chatting. Everything is done efficiently right in the comfort of one's home.

You have total control of your schedules, unlike in attending conventional class discussions. This means that you also set your own learning pace, going online only whenever you are free to do so. Earning a college degree also means that you can attend to your lessons wherever you are - at home, in the workplace or during a trip. Earning a college degree has never been as convenient and efficient.

How to Get Into a Great College

Beginning the college process can be a daunting task because there is no fixed formula for getting into college and moreover, whatever combination of courses one studied at high school makes no difference in the success rate of getting admission to your dream school. Grades, SAT/ACT scores, and class rank are certainly looked into, but while doing well in all three may be enough to get you into some schools, it doesn't necessarily mean you'll get into all your choices. In fact, even students with perfect SAT scores and straight A's are sometimes denied admission by some of the more elite colleges and universities. Here are some tips that will help you navigate the admissions process and succeed in your application.

You must know that selective colleges have more qualified applicants than their limit. This is where extracurricular activities come into play. In fact, extracurricular activities can often tilt the decision in your favor when compared to other students with equivalent grades/test scores but without much in the way of activities because they demonstrate your motivation and time-management skills. You should remember to inform college if pursuing academics and an after-school job or any other extenuating circumstances. According to The Princeton Review, highly selective schools generally place emphasis than average on a good essay. The essay questions on college applications are usually very open-ended, so it is prudent to talk about your experience or aspect of you or your life that was particularly meaningful.

Awards or other recognitions and achievements can weigh into your application's consideration. Be sure to inform them if you have achieved any because good colleges and universities look for leaders and achievers and not just academic performers.

Recommendations of your teachers and counselors do matter. Get a letter of recommendation from a teacher or counselor who thinks you're brilliant and include it with your application packet. Similarly, if a family member went to your college of choice, you may receive (not necessarily) some preferential consideration in admissions and this could count even more if more than one family member attended the college.

Most importantly, start planning early to get into the schools you want. Do your research, collect updated information on the most sought-after colleges and universities and their admission criteria in advance. Ready for Online Distance Education? Read these 10 Rules first

Check to ensure the college is accredited by a legitimate accrediting agency. Accreditation means the college and its programs meet certain set educational quality and standards. This also means courses and credits acquired can be easily transferred to another accredited institution, whether online or brick and mortar college. You will stand a better chance of securing employment or promotion at work if you have an accredited degree.

Be on the look-out for unaccredited online distance education colleges otherwise known as "degree mills". There are many fake institutions granting "accreditation" to any organization willing to pay some money for it. Before you pick your college, make sure you research that it is accredited by a legit body. If you are not sure the college you wish to attend has a legitimate accreditation, consult with the United States Department of Education or CHEA to confirm.

To ensure that the degree program your are considering is aligned with your long-term educational goals, especially if you think you'll need to advance your degree (for example from bachelors to MBA), it'll benefit you to check if the online distance education institution you'd want to attend for your MBA accepts transfer credits from another online institution.

Class size is as important in online education as it is in a traditional college classroom. Do your research on the average class sizes at the online distance education institution you are considering. Small classes make it easier to interact and voice your opinion.

Find out if the faculty hold any credentials and if they are qualified to teach the program you want to enroll in. If you can dig further to find out what degrees they hold and if they are experienced in teaching online students, this will save you the distress of finding out later that your instructor is a fellow un-qualified student with no education skills.

Find out if it easy to contact your instructor or administration should you have questions or need help. The level of support offered to students varies considerably from college to college. Choose one in line with your needs and expectations.

One of the great things about online distance education programs is that you can begin almost anytime. Thus you shouldn't let anyone rush you into starting your program until you feel ready to put the time and effort it will require for you to succeed.

Verify whether during the course of your program, there are classes that will require residency or if you will be able to complete the entire program online. This will help you prepare in advance.

Most online colleges offer financial aid and tuition assistance. You'll be pleased to discover how much financial help you have available inform of loans, scholarships, financial aid and other federal loans. Some institutions even have tuition payment plans and employer-reimbursement programs. Find out if your college of interest offers such programs.

Take your time to research your best degree option and college out there. Don't settle for less than you deserve. Unlike there before when online programs were limited, now there are enormous options and colleges to choose from as most traditional colleges are already offering some programs online.

Evaluating One's Self - The Key to Successful Online Studying

In any decision that an individual will make, they should first evaluate themselves. Since this kind of education is for those who do not have enough time going to school, some active students will find this kind of learning a boring type. Some accounts or studies would say that this kind of learning is for those who are working already, but still want to pursue higher studies.

Before deciding to enroll in any online degree, evaluating one's self on different aspects should be the first task of the student. First, evaluate the self based on the study habits. Second, think about the learning formats that will work best for the student. Third, think about the available time that can be given to studying. Fourth, think about one's self in the future.

Evaluating the self based on the individual's study habits is very important before entering an online degree. The student who s planning to get an online degree should spend some time asking himself if he is used to reading a lot of reference materials in the computer or if he is used to reading reference materials in a hard copy. This is important because most reference materials in online studying are accessible in the web. Some students especially those in school have the tendency not to read a lot of reading materials assigned to them, for some petty reasons like they went to a bar, they watched a basketball game or they forgot to read it. If in the event that they are really decided to pursue an online degree, then they should have time to read the reference materials. The petty reasons mentioned above will not work, because since all materials are accessible in the internet, they are available 24 hours, 7 days a week.

The student should also evaluate himself if he likes studying alone with the computer or he likes studying with his classmates to make learning more interactive. If he likes studying with his classmates then, he should think twice if he likes to pursue an online degree. Online studying would only require the student to study alone, since the reading materials are in the computer. And one more thing, he cannot interact with his classmates face-to-face with this kind of learning. Since this is online studying, his classmates might be located around the world.

Second thing that should be put into consideration is the learning format that is very easy for the student. In pursuing an online degree the student will be exposed to different kinds of online reading materials. The student should be ready for that. Whatever online degree that he or she will pursue, all reading materials will be online.

The third thing that should be put into consideration with regards to taking online education is the online degree that the student will take. In this, the student needs a lot of self-evaluation because the student cannot just shift to another degree if he did not like the current degree he is taking. It will be too expensive for him.

Selecting the Best University For an Accredited Online MBA Degree

The acquisition of an online MBA degree from an accredited university is of paramount importance to kick-start your career. Some students commit the mistake of earning an MBA from a university, which is not accredited. When you study business administration at an unaccredited university and receive an online degree which is not approved, you are going to face plenty of problems in finding a good job in a reputable organization, as employers are going to give preference to students who have attained their online MBA degree from an accredited university.

So how exactly can you pick the best university to acquire your online MBA degree from? Following are some factors you should take into consideration, which would help you decide on the best possible online university for your degree:

Course Structure

When selecting a university for an online MBA degree, you need to take into account the course structure of the program. Make sure that the course structure is designed properly and fits well into the present industry scenario. For example, if you are interested in acquiring an MBA focused on marketing, then the kinds of marketing strategies you are going to learn are crucial. Point to be noted here is that marketing strategies that were successful 10 years back may not work at this moment of time because market conditions do not remain constant and keep on changing with the passage of time.

Faculty

Faculty members also play a prominent part in any MBA program, may it be on campus or online. After all, they are the ones who teach you all the concepts & strategies related to your program. Before selecting any university, check the qualification and experience of faculty members. There is no point in taking admission in a university whose faculty members lack experience in terms of teaching, particularly when it comes to teaching online. In an ideal scenario, you should opt for an online college or university where experts from various industries are a part of the faculty.

Placement Facility

As soon as you acquire your online MBA degree, you would want to get placed at a good organization. With competition being so intense in the market, this is not going to be easy. And that is where the role of placement cells at colleges and universities comes in. Most of the reputed online colleges and universities have placement cell whose main responsibility is to provide job placement to their students as soon as they acquire their degree. Before enrolling in any university, make sure that they provide placement facility to their online students.

Fees

Some students believe that online universities that charge high tuition rates are the best institutions. This is a very wrong concept as most of the reputed online universities do not charge hefty tuition rates from their online MBA students. As a matter of fact, it has been found that usually it is the bogus universities and degree mills which charge huge fees for their online MBA programs.

Subject Material

To acquire an accredited and acceptable online MBA degree, you need to study high quality course material. If that is not the case, your entire educational journey is going to suffer immensely. Therefore, before taking admission in any online college or university, see how they prepare the subject material, more importantly, what you should not is whether they take any expert help or is the preparations of the online course material an in-house affair.

By taking the aforementioned steps, you can locate the best possible and accredited online university for you to acquire your online MBA degree from. The consideration of these facts would help you assure yourself that you are not being charged extra for your program and are being taught the best subject material, which is as good as the curriculum taught to traditional MBA students.
